List.cpp
#include <iostream> #include <list> #include <vector> #include <cstdlib> using namespace std; double RandomDouble(); void Report(list<double> &L); void Output(list<double> &L); void Output(vector<double> &V); vector<double> ListToVector(const list<double> &L); list<double> VectorToList(const vector<double> &V); void TestList(); void TestListToVector(); void TestVectorToList(); int main(int argc, char* argv[]) { //TestList(); //TestListToVector(); TestVectorToList(); return 0; } void TestList() { list<double> L; Report(L); for(unsigned int i = 0; i < 10; i++) L.push_back(RandomDouble()); Report(L); Output(L); //erase the second element list<double>::iterator it1 = L.begin(); it1++; L.erase(it1); Report(L); Output(L); L.clear(); Report(L); } void TestListToVector() { list<double> L; for(unsigned int i = 0; i < 10; i++) L.push_back(RandomDouble()); Output(L); vector<double> V = ListToVector(L); Output(V); } void TestVectorToList() { vector<double> V; for(unsigned int i = 0; i < 10; i++) V.push_back(RandomDouble()); Output(V); list<double> L = VectorToList(V); Output(L); } double RandomDouble() { //produce a random double between 0 and 1 return drand48(); } void Output(list<double> &L) { //for(list<double>::iterator it1 = L.begin(); it1 != L.end(); ++it1) for(list<double>::iterator it1 = L.begin(); it1 != L.end(); it1++) { cout << " " << *it1; } cout << endl; } void Output(vector<double> &V) { for(unsigned int i = 0; i < V.size(); i++) { cout << " " << V[i]; } cout << endl; } void Report(list<double> &L) { std::cout << "Size: " << L.size() << " Empty? " << L.empty() << std::endl; } vector<double> ListToVector(const list<double> &L) { vector<double> V(L.begin(), L.end()); return V; } list<double> VectorToList(const vector<double> &V) { list<double> L(V.begin(), V.end()); return L; }
